In Hypertension (high blood pressure) Terapress 1 Tablet works by relaxing your blood vessels and making it easier for your heart to pump blood around your body. This lowers blood pressure. If your blood pressure is controlled, you are less at risk of having a heart attack, stroke, or kidney problems. The medicine must be taken regularly as prescribed to be effective. You may not feel the immediate benefit after taking the medicine, however, it works in the long term to keep you well.
Most side effects do not require any medical attention and disappear as your body adjusts to the medicine. Consult your doctor if they persist or if you're worried about them.
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Terapress 1 Tablet may be taken with or without food, but it is better to take it at a fixed time.
Terapress 1 Tablet is an alpha-blocker. It lowers blood pressure by relaxing blood vessels. It also relaxes the muscles around the bladder exit and prostate, which makes it easier to urinate.
UNSAFE - It is unsafe to consume alcohol with Terapress 1 Tablet.
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R - Terapress 1 Tablet may be unsafe to use during pregnancy. Although there are limited studies in humans, animal studies have shown harmful effects on the developing baby. Your doctor will weigh the benefits and any potential risks before prescribing it to you. Please consult your doctor.
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R - Terapress 1 Tablet is probably un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ug may pass into the breastmilk and harm the baby.
UNSAFE - Terapress 1 Tablet may decrease alertness, affect your vision or make you feel sleepy and dizzy. Do not drive if these symptoms occur.
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ED - Terapress 1 Tablet is safe to use in patients with kidney disease. No dose adjustment of Terapress 1 Tablet is recommended.
CAUTION - Terapress 1 Tablet should be used with caution in patients with liver disease. Dose adjustment of Terapress 1 Tablet may be needed. Please consult your doctor. Use of Terapress 1 Tablet is not recommended in patients with severe liver disease.
If you miss a dose of Terapress 1 Tablet, skip it and continue with your normal schedule. Do not double the dose.
